Wet ball milling was used to exfoliate graphite platelets into graphenes in a liquid medium. Multilayered graphite nanosheets with a thickness of 30 to 80 nm were dispersed into N,Ndimethylformamide (DMF) and exfoliated by shearforcedominated ball milling carried out in a planetary mill. The mill consists of a rotating shaft with four attached parallel knives and a screen occupying one fourth of the 360 degree rotation. The mill is best used to crack whole grains with a minimum of "fines". It is not used as a final process for reducing the size of ingredients used in fish feeds. Screening

Jan 25, 2011· Stone milling was the only way to make grain into flour for millennia. Farmers would sell their grain to the mill in their area and the mill would process that grain and sell it to bakers. Stone mills were powered by water or wind to grind the grain between two large stones.

Mar 11, 2016· Wet Milling. The most common method of producing nanoparticles, wet milling is a more effective milling technique than the wellknown dry milling. Media milling is known as the 'classical' wet milling technique; this process treats a dispersion of concentrated drug in an aqueous or nonaqueous liquid medium with milling balls.
Ethanol Production Processes : ›DRY MILLING ›WET MILLING ›CELLULOSIC BIOMASS. WET MILLING. In wet milling, the grain is soaked or "steeped" in water and dilute sulfurous acid for 24 to 48 hours. This steeping facilitates the separation of the grain into its many component parts.
